Job Responsibilities
  • Patient Access staff are responsible for assigning accurate MRNs, completing medical necessity / compliance checks, providing proper patient instructions, collecting insurance information, receiving, and processing physician orders, and utilizing an overlay tool while providing excellent customer service as measured by Press Ganey.
  • Operates the telephone switchboard to relay incoming, outgoing, and inter-office calls as applicable.
  • Adhere to policies and provide excellent customer service in these interactions with the appropriate level of compassion.
  • Patient Access staff will be held accountable for point of service goals as assigned.
  • Patient Access staff are responsible for the utilization of quality auditing and reporting systems to ensure accounts are corrected. These activities may include accounts for other employees, departments, and facilities. Conducts audits of accounts and assures that all forms are completed accurately and timely to meet audit standards and provides statistical data to Patient Access leadership.
  • Patient Access Staff are responsible for the pre-registration of patient accounts prior to patient visits, including inbound and outbound calling to obtain demographic, insurance, and other patient information including patient financial liabilities and point of service collections.
  • The Patient Access Staff explains general consent for treatment forms to the patient/guarantor/legal guardian, obtains necessary signatures, and distributes patient education documents and forms.
  • Reviews eligibility responses in insurance verification system and appropriately selects the applicable insurance plan code, enters benefit data into system to support POS and billing processes to assist with a clean claim rate.
  • Responsible for accurately screening medical necessity using the Advanced Beneficiary Notice (ABN) software to inform Medicare patients of possible non-payment of tests and distribution of the ABN as appropriate. Responsible for distribution and documentation of other designated forms and pamphlets.
